It is essential for life coaches to have a system in place for managing multiple clients efficiently. Without one, it is easy to become overwhelmed and disorganized, leading to potential mistakes and unsatisfied clients. In this article, we will discuss how to manage multiple clients effectively as a life coach.  

1. Set realistic expectations 

The first step to managing lots of life coaching clients is to set realistic expectations. You need to be honest with yourself about how many clients you can handle. Taking on too many clients can lead to burnout and can compromise the quality of your coaching, so it’s important to find the right balance between meeting the needs of your clients and taking care of yourself. 

When you meet with potential clients, be clear about your availability. Set boundaries around your time and let clients know when you are not available. This will help you manage expectations and avoid over-committing yourself.

2. Understanding your client’s needs 

Before creating a system for managing multiple clients, it is important to understand each client’s individual needs. Every client is different and requires a unique approach, so taking the time to understand their goals, challenges, and expectations is crucial. This can be achieved by conducting a thorough intake session or assessment before beginning any coaching sessions. By doing so, you can tailor your coaching style and create a personalized plan for each client. 

3. Leverage technology 

Managing lots of life coaching clients requires a strong system. You need to be able to keep track of appointments, progress notes, and client goals. Without a system in place, it can be easy to miss important details or forget about appointments. 

There are many tools available to help you stay organized, including calendar apps, project management software, and note-taking apps. 4. Practice self-care  

Managing multiple clients can be challenging, and it’s essential to practice self-care to prevent burnout and maintain your energy and focus as you switch context between each client and then your business. Make sure to prioritize your physical and emotional well-being by getting enough sleep, exercise, and healthy meals. You can also practice mindfulness, meditation, or other stress-reducing techniques to manage your stress levels. 

5. Seek support from other coaches  

Working with other coaches can provide you with additional support and resources to manage multiple clients effectively. Joining a coaching community or networking with other coaches can help you share ideas, learn new techniques, and get feedback on your coaching strategies. 

In conclusion, managing lots of life coaching clients requires careful planning and organization. It’s important to set realistic expectations, develop a system for the organization, and communicate effectively with your clients. By following these tips, not only do you navigate the question of how to manage multiple clients, but also provide quality coaching to all your clients while avoiding burnout and maintaining your own well-being. Remember, it’s not about how many clients you have, but how well you can serve them.
